PM’s policies have created space for terrorists in J & K: Rahul

New Delhi:  Two days after the terrorist attack on Amarnath pilgrims which left seven pilgrims dead, Congress vice-president Rahul Gandhi today attacked the Narendra Modi government for its policy on Jammu and Kashmir, saying that the PM’s policies had created a space for terrorists in the state.
Charging Mr Modi with forming a government with PDP in the state for ‘short term political gains’, Mr Gandhi, in a series of tweets, said the short term political gain for Mr Modi from the PDP alliance had cost India massively.
‘Modi’s policies have created space for terrorists in Kashmir.
Grave strategic blow for India.
Short term political gain for Modi from PDP alliance has cost India massively,’ he tweeted.   (UNI)
